    How far along: 5w4d

    Symptoms: early morning insomnia, frequent trips to the bathroom and some mild cramping

    IF Journey: This was our 37th cycle trying with a diagnosis of unexplained infertility and one ectopic last year that was resolved with MTX. We had 6 rounds of IUI, coupled with Clomid and Femara last year with no luck.

    I took prednisone 10mg a day during this cycle after reading many studies out of Australia and bam! We got pregnant. Thanking my lucky stars.

    How far along?

    im 8 weeks and 1 day.

    symptoms?

    intense hunger in the mornings but overall I feel great. With my two DDs I had every symptom. Nausea, vomiting, consultation, fatigue, etc. I am feeling very lucky this time. I was nervous yesterday about my ultrasound but baby was measuring a day ahead and looked perfect.

    IF Journey?

    We conceived both our daughters very very easily. This time it took about 8 months of trying and then I miscarried at 5.5 weeks. Took another 7+ months plus Clomid for both of us for this baby.  Unexplained infertility. We were going to do Clomid and IUI in June but ended up thankfully not needing to. I will say it’s very difficult being a labor and delivery nurse (even with children already at home) dealing with unexplained IF. I know many many people have it way worse than we did but it was trying time and I gained 37# I think from the stress and emotions of trying. I was at a great weight before last year. Prior to ttc, we tried (and failed) to adopt for 2.5 years and we were left very confused and frustrated.
